How did you learn to produce such nice graphics? Were you taught at school or have you just picked up Dpaint and developed a skill from there? Have you and qualifications in Art? |
| Flame: |
My graphics don't look good to me - I'm flattered when people say they like them but after spending so many hours looking at them whilst they are being drawn, they don't really have an effect on me (everyone feels like that I suppose) It helps to jot down any ideas you have the moment you get them (and make a sketch). Then when you get asked to come up with something in a short space of time, you don't have to go through the agony of trying to force your brain to 'have' an idea. One example of not doing the above is my Punisher logo (very uninspired and rushed). Both my grandfathers were artists, my mother is a former art teacher and my father is a colour technician so I'd have been very pissed off if I couldn't draw... |
| Red Devil: |
OK. I'm not one for asking people to name their top three favourites or anything boring like that, but is there anyone in particular in the UK, or indeed, the scene as a whole that influences you, or impresses you? Do you draw inspiration from them and have you had any sexual experiences with them?!?! |
| Flame: |
There are many guys whose work I enjoy - On the graphics side, J.O.E. is one of the few people who can come up with really original IDEAS although his technique is not the best (this doesn't stop people trying to copy it though!). Cougar has an almost 'spotless' technique (I really liked his dog & devil head), but most original stuff I've seen from him (logos, etc.) hasn't been as good. Rack also has a nice technique but his stuff looks flat to me - also he just copies sections of fantasy art pictures for his textures. I had to laugh when Spider entered the charts - I'm sure he's a very nice person but everything I've ever seen from him has hurt my eyes (I can't believe someone paid him to draw the Action Replay MK III logo - Aaaarghhh!!!). Musically, I find it quite frustrating that we are no longer treated to Walkman classics - hopefully this will change when CRB get themselves sorted out. Similarly, it is sad that we don't hear Uncle Tom tunes nowadays - they are always full of energy. Bruno has more knowledge about tune structure, styles and rhythm than anyone (he is one of the most underrated musicians ever). It is a great pity he has quit the scene. Two 'newcomers' who really know what they are doing are Audiomonster and Heatbeat. Also Moby tunes are always funky. Firefox's "Spank It" was so catchy (will be nice to work with you at Arcane!). | Red Devil: |
Gor blimey! Back to the sane world I think! What's your opinion of the UK scene at the moment? Now Mr.T and Action Man have been busted, many guys have predicted that this is the beginning of the end. I DON'T share this view myself; what are your views? Who do you see as the premier groups in the UK scene, and who has the most potential for scene greatness? |
| Flame: |
I must say that I'm not 'into' the scene like many guys are (i.e. I.don't give a shit who's left what group, who's just bought a modem, who's currently awaiting sentence for a charge of animal harrassment, etc.). The scene appears to be 'growing up' in the sense that it's becoming money-orientated with groups timing the release of big demos to coincide with parties (in the hope of grabbing some prize money). You may say this destroys some of the scene's original spirit, but I'm buggered if I'm doing the amount of work the Punisher required only to end up with the satisfaction of completing the demo (which isn't far off the truth). |

| Red Devil: |
Do you do graphics PURELY for the fun of it, or do you have a burning desire to become world No.1? Have you done any commercial work? |
| Flame: |
Sorry to disillusion you, boys and girls, but (as many people are now realising) the charts do not always reflect talent but usually just who's the most well-known. For example, both 4-mat and Romeo Knight spent aeons in the no.1 spot (RK without even releasing anything!) and while they are both talented guys (in my opinion Matt in particular has developed very well as a musician). I'm sure they would be the first to admit that they don't deserve to be rated higher than Bruno or Walkman. I've had several offers of commercial work but it never comes to fruition ('A' levels see to that). If all goes well I will be starting full time work for Arcane Design in the summer (unless something better comes along!). |
